WebName: Azalea, evergreen azalea, deciduous azalea, Rhododendron cultivars. Height: deciduous: usually 1–3m; evergreen: from 30cm to 3 m. Foliage: deciduous or evergreen, depending on the species or cultivar. Climate: deciduous azaleas require a cool temperate climate; evergreen azaleas can be grown in both cool and warm temperate climates.
